The Hand and Sceptre is a new style of contemporary country pub serving fresh food in a stylish surrounding. The pub dates back to 1728 and was named after the original landlord George New-Hand – now things have really changed! The pub has been wonderfully restored, incorporating the values of traditional pub hospitality with modern designs.
